What can you take in cabin luggage on ryanair

One item is allowed in the cabin dimensions of 40 cm x 20 cm x 25 cm. The cabin bag must fit under the seat in front of you. Personal belongings such as a small backpack, handbag, or laptop case that meet these criteria are acceptable.

Additionally, passengers may carry a duty-free shopping bag purchased after security screening. However, it is important that this bag fits within the size limits previously mentioned.

Travelers should be well-prepared for security screenings. Ensure liquids are in containers of 100 ml or less, all contained within a clear, resealable plastic bag with a maximum capacity of 1 liter. Items like medications, baby food, and special dietary products are exempt from these restrictions but must be declared at the checkpoint.

FAQ:

What items are allowed in cabin luggage on Ryanair?

Ryanair permits one small cabin bag measuring up to 40cm x 20cm x 25cm for free. This bag must fit under the seat in front of you. In addition, passengers who have purchased priority boarding are allowed to bring an extra larger cabin bag, up to 55cm x 40cm x 20cm, weighing up to 10 kg. Common items you can pack include clothing, personal toiletries (within liquid restrictions), electronic devices, and small personal items such as books or food. It’s advisable to check Ryanair’s official site for the latest guidelines, as policies can change.

Are there restrictions on liquids in cabin luggage with Ryanair?

Yes, there are specific restrictions regarding liquids in cabin luggage when flying with Ryanair. Passengers are allowed to carry liquids in containers of no more than 100ml each. All containers must fit within a single transparent, resealable plastic bag, which should not exceed 1 liter in capacity. Examples of liquids include beverages, creams, gels, and aerosol products. This bag must be presented separately at security checks for easier screening.

Can I take food or drinks in my cabin luggage on Ryanair?

Passengers can bring food and non-alcoholic drinks in their cabin luggage on Ryanair. However, if you choose to bring a drink, it must comply with the liquid restrictions mentioned earlier, meaning it should be in a container of 100ml or less. Solid food items like sandwiches, snacks, and fruits are generally permissible without restrictions. Purchasing food or drinks after security usually allows you to take them on board without issues.
